Happy birthday, Kate Middleton!

Thursday marked the Duchess of Cambridge's 38th birthday and she received quite the fanfare from the royal family. In a special shout-out from the official Royal Family account, which posted a series of pictures of Kate and Queen Elizabeth II together over the years, Her Majesty sent her well wishes: "Wishing The Duchess of Cambridge a very Happy Birthday!"

Kate also got a sweet birthday wish from the Kensington Palace Instagram account. Sharing a stunning portrait of the mom of four dressed casually in a sweater and jeans while taking in the beauty of nature, the post read, "Thank you everyone for all your lovely messages on The Duchess of Cambridge's birthday!"

In-laws Meghan Markle and Prince Harry also chimed in with a message of their own, leaving the b-day girl a comment from the official Sussex Royal account saying, "Wishing a very happy birthday to The Duchess of Cambridge today!"

Their comment comes one day after the Duke and Duchess of Sussex announced that they were stepping back from their royal duties, a decision that blindsided the royal family. Once news broke of their shocking decision, BBC News reported that Meghan and Harry never informed Buckingham Palace, Prince Charles or Prince William of their plans to make their announcement, which according to a spokesperson for the palace, left the Queen feeling "disappointed."

As per their statement, Meghan and Harry will "carve out a progressive new role within this institution" while "continuing to fully support Her Majesty The Queen" and working "to become financially independent." 

Being that this is an unprecedented move for the royal family, there's no telling what the future will bring. "We do not know how this will play out in the next months, the next few years," a royal expert told E! News. But as their statement stressed, Meghan and Harry intend to maintain a positive relationship with the royal family.

"We look forward to sharing the full details of this exciting next step in due course, as we continue to collaborate with Her Majesty The Queen, The Prince of Wales, The Duke of Cambridge and all relevant parties," the couple said in their statement. "Until then, please accept our deepest thanks for your continued support." 

In addition to establishing a new identity for themselves and kick-starting their new Sussex Royal charity initiative, Meghan and Harry also announced that they and 8-month-old son Archie Harrison will be spending more time across the pond

"We now plan to balance our time between the United Kingdom and North America, continuing to honour our duty to The Queen, the Commonwealth, and our patronages," the statement continued. "This geographic balance will enable us to raise our son with an appreciation for the royal tradition into which he was born, while also providing our family with the space to focus on the next chapter, including the launch of our new charitable entity."
